XML 85 R70.htm IDEA: XBRL DOCUMENT v3.25.0.1
Income Taxes - Schedule of Provision (Benefit) for Income Taxes (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2024
Dec. 31, 2023
Dec. 31, 2022
Loss before taxes      
Domestic $ (53,871) $ (56,342) $ (64,071)
Foreign 391 (979) (1,642)
Loss before income taxes (53,480) (57,321) (65,713)
Current tax expense:      
Federal   105  
State 89 58 96
Foreign 1,358 730 315
Total current tax expense 1,447 893 411
Deferred tax expense (benefit):      
Federal (10,204) (11,309) (15,900)
State (868) (1,402) (1,939)
Foreign (885) (1,099) (909)
Change in valuation allowance 11,669 13,129 18,273
Total deferred tax expense (benefit) (288) (681) (475)
Total tax expense (benefit):      
Federal (10,204) (11,204) (15,900)
State (779) (1,344) (1,843)
Foreign 473 (368) (594)
Change in valuation allowance 11,669 13,129 18,273
Total income tax expense (benefit) $ 1,159 $ 213 $ (64)